Clinton +2 in North Carolina By: IndyRep (R-MT) on 2016-10-13 @ 19:35:59 Question: Your North Carolina presidential ballot includes three candidates listed in the following order... (READ 15.1-15.3 LIST OF NAME AND PARTIES)... At this point which candidate will you vote for or lean toward? 45% Clinton (D) 43% Trump (R) 5% Johnson (L) 5% Undecided About this Poll The North Carolina survey of 500 likely voters was conducted Oct. 10 – Oct. 12 using live telephone interviews of households where respondents indicated they were very or somewhat likely to vote in the 2016 general election. The margin of error is +/-4.4 percentage points at a 95 percent level of confidence. Login to Post Comments Forum Thread for this Poll |
